TITLE: Design of a novel electrochemical cell for electrochemical exfoliation of graphite into graphene

SUMMARY

The objective of this thesis is to design and test a new electrochemical cell for the mass production of graphene using electrochemical exfoliation of graphite. Although several techniques have been developed by different research groups, most of them are based on the exfoliation of a solid body of graphite, which usually increases the cost of the process or lowers the quality of the final product. In this case, the research is oriented towards a cost-effective set up which uses graphite powder instead of a rigid graphite body.
